BP Invests $5 Million in Geospatial Analytics Company Satelytics

2020-06-23 15:51:31| OGI

BP Ventures has invested $5 million in Satelytics, a cloud-based geospatial analytics software company that uses advanced spectral imagery and machine learning to monitor environmental changes, including methane emissions, the company said on June 23.
